The story begins in the 1980s, and not in an operating theatre. Research into human spaceflight and battlefield medicine produced the first of two key components: a three-dimensional head-mounted display. The second, a telemanipulation instrument allowing a surgeon to operate at a distance, came out of work at Stanford aimed at military use. At the same time laparoscopic surgery was developing rapidly, and the idea of combining these technologies into what we now call robotic surgery became plausible.
History of robotic urology surgery
In the early 1990s two US companies were competing to build it.
- Computer Motion Inc.
- Intuitive Surgical

Intuitive Surgical’s “da Vinci” system succeeded so decisively that the company went on to acquire Computer Motion, and it has effectively held the field ever since.
Five generations of the da Vinci system have followed.
- da Vinci 2000
- Early 2000s, designed for coronary surgery but usable for urological procedures
- da Vinci S
- Mid-2000s, improved instrument arms and setup
- da Vinci Si
- 2009
- High-definition visualisation
- 手指式离合器装置
- da Vinci Xi
- 2014
- 3D vision through a smaller-calibre camera port
- Slimmer robotic arms
- Multi-quadrant surgery becomes possible
- da Vinci SP
- 2018
- Single-port surgery — every instrument passes through one incision

Advantages of robotic urology surgery
- Much smaller wounds than open surgery, with considerably less blood loss and less pain afterwards.
- Smaller wounds mean faster recovery.
- The robotic arm has a far greater range of motion than the human wrist and than laparoscopic instruments, which allows more precise work and makes more complex operations feasible.
- Magnified three-dimensional vision, which matters most when operating deep in a small space — exactly the situation in most urological surgery.
Limitations of robotic urology surgery
- Operating time can be longer than open or laparoscopic surgery because of the time spent docking the robotic arms, although this narrows considerably with an experienced robotic surgeon.
- It costs more.
- It requires a properly trained robotic surgeon.
- If an emergency arises during the operation, the surgeon may need to convert to open or laparoscopic surgery.
- It is not the right choice for every operation.
- It is not available in every hospital, so patients need to seek out a centre that offers it.
What the robot does not change
It is worth being clear about one thing that gets lost in the enthusiasm. Robotic surgery is a route into the body, not a different operation. A robotic prostatectomy removes the same prostate as an open prostatectomy, and the risks that belong to the operation itself remain: bleeding, infection, injury to nearby structures, blood clots in the legs or lungs, and the functional consequences specific to the procedure — for prostatectomy, that means erectile dysfunction and a period of urinary incontinence, neither of which the robot abolishes.
The other honest point is that outcomes track the surgeon more closely than the machine. A well-trained robotic surgeon with volume in the particular operation is what makes the difference; the presence of a da Vinci system in a hospital brochure is not, on its own, a quality measure. It is a fair question to ask any surgeon how many of your particular operation they perform.
After any robotic or laparoscopic urological operation, some symptoms need to be reported rather than waited out: fever or shaking chills, increasing rather than settling abdominal pain, a wound that becomes red, swollen or starts discharging, calf pain or swelling, sudden breathlessness or chest pain, and inability to pass urine once the catheter has been removed. Sudden breathlessness or chest pain means an emergency department, not a phone call.

什么是机器人辅助泌尿外科手术?它与传统手术有何不同?
Robotic urology surgery uses the da Vinci surgical system to perform minimally invasive operations with robotic arms controlled by the surgeon. Compared to open surgery, it offers smaller wounds, less blood loss, less postoperative pain, and faster recovery. The 3D magnified visualization and greater range of motion of robotic arms also allow for greater surgical precision, especially in deep and confined anatomical spaces typical in urology. The robot is the route of access; the operation performed inside is the same one.
Q2:机器人手术可以治疗哪些泌尿系统疾病?
机器人手术是几种泌尿外科手术的金标准,包括用于前列腺癌的机器人前列腺切除术、用于肾脏肿瘤的机器人肾脏切除术、用于输尿管盆腔连接狭窄的机器人肾盂成形术以及用于膀胱癌的机器人膀胱切除术。Soarawee 医生在曼谷医院总部使用达芬奇 Xi 系统进行这些手术。.
第三问:机器人泌尿外科手术安全吗?
Yes. Robotic urology surgery has an established safety profile supported by extensive clinical evidence. However, it is still major surgery: bleeding, infection, injury to nearby structures, blood clots and the functional consequences specific to each operation remain possible, and the robotic approach does not remove them. Outcomes depend more on the surgeon’s training and case volume than on the machine itself, and in an emergency the surgeon can convert to open or laparoscopic surgery.
